The SSC has launched a revolutionary self slot selection system for the Combined Higher Secondary Level Examination (CHSL) 2025 Tier-I. For the first time ever, candidates can pick their preferred:

  • Exam city
  • Test date
  • Morning/afternoon shift

This facility went live on October 22 and will disappear forever on October 28. If you miss this window, you miss your chance to appear for the exam!

Step-by-Step Guide: How to Choose Your Perfect Slot

Follow these simple steps to secure your ideal exam slot:

Step 1: Visit the Official Portal

Go directly to the SSC official website. Look for the “Candidate Login” section.

Step 2: Login Details

Enter your:

  • Registration number
  • Password

Can’t remember your credentials? Use the “Forgot Password” option immediately!

Step 3: Slot Selection Dashboard

Once logged in:

  1. Click “Choose Exam City, Date & Shift”
  2. See your 3 pre-selected cities from application
  3. Check available dates/shifts for each city

Step 4: Make Your Selection

Pick your preferred combination:

Option What You Can Choose
City From your original 3 choices
Date Available between November 12-30, 2025
Shift Morning (9-10:30 AM) or Afternoon (1:30-3 PM)

Step 5: Final Confirmation

Double-check your selection. Once confirmed, NO CHANGES are allowed. Download the confirmation page for future reference.

Critical Deadlines You Can’t Miss

Mark these dates in red on your calendar:

  • October 22, 2025: Slot selection begins
  • October 28, 2025: Last date for selection
  • November 12, 2025: Revised exam start date

“The October 28 deadline is absolute,” warns SSC’s latest notice. “No requests for changes will be entertained afterward.”

Special Notes for Regional Language Candidates

If you opted for a regional language paper:

  • Fewer slots available
  • Book early to secure preferred options
  • Be ready with alternative city choices

What Happens If You Don’t Choose?

The SSC makes it clear:

  1. No slot selection = No exam appearance
  2. Your application will be considered canceled
  3. No refund of application fees

Exam Date Drama: Why Dates Changed

The CHSL 2025 Tier-I exam was originally scheduled for September 8-18. But SSC postponed it without explanation, causing panic among candidates. The new November 12 start date brings relief but also compression of exam schedules.

Technical Tips for Smooth Slot Booking

Avoid these common mistakes:

  • Don’t wait until last day – servers may crash
  • Clear browser cache before starting
  • Use desktop/laptop instead of mobile
  • Keep scanned documents ready
